RESTRAINT
"Environmental Regulations and Lead Disposal Issues"
Stringent environmental regulations concerning lead recycling and disposal remain a key restraint. Over 18% of global VRLA manufacturers report compliance challenges due to tightening waste management laws. The European Union’s Battery Directive requires 95% lead recovery efficiency, pushing producers to invest in costly recycling systems. This raises production expenses by 12–15%. Moreover, lead emission control during recycling adds logistical complexity, limiting small and medium producers’ competitiveness in developed markets.

CHALLENGE
"Competition from Lithium-Ion Technology"
The most significant market challenge arises from the rapid penetration of lithium-ion batteries, which now account for 46% of total industrial energy storage systems. Lithium-ion’s high energy density of 150–200 Wh/kg contrasts with VRLA’s 50 Wh/kg, creating strong substitution pressure. However, VRLA retains advantages in cost (up to 60% lower per unit energy stored) and safety. The industry faces challenges in repositioning VRLA technology as a dependable, low-maintenance alternative for medium-duty applications amid rising lithium competition.
